Famously known as the ‘Entertainment Capital of the World’, the extraordinary city of Las Vegas needs no introduction. Surrounded by the vast expanse of the Mojave Desert in the state of Nevada, Las Vegas enjoys a pleasant climate year-round, which is perfect for the millions of visitors who flock here every year. At the heart of the city you will find dozens of world famous casinos and resorts that offer a wide variety of extravagant entertainment in their theatres and nightclubs. The city also boasts countless restaurants, cafés and bars, as well as some of the best shopping opportunities to be found anywhere in the country.
